Derby to Stoke-on-Trent by train

A train trip from Derby to Stoke-on-Trent takes about 1hrs 32 mins on average, covering roughly 30 miles (49 kilometres). With around 20 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£12.30,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Derby to Stoke-on-Trent start from £12.30 one way, or £12.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Derby to Stoke-on-Trent are available for £14.60 one way, or £17.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

Derby Train Station is well-equipped to handle a variety of passenger needs. The ticket office operates with extensive hours, from early morning at 04:55 until late at night at 22:45 during the week, with slightly adjusted hours on the weekend. For those who prefer digital solutions, ticket machines are available and include facilities for collecting online purchases. Accessibility is a focus here, with step-free access across the entire station, supported by lifts and tactile paving.

This station has a notable commitment to customer assistance and safety. Staff are readily available to help, and several help points are dotted around for immediate inquiries. While there are no luggage storage facilities, the lost property office at Nottingham offers a robust service for misplaced items. Safety is enhanced with CCTV covering both the station and car park areas.

Onward Travel Options

For seamless transitions to other modes of transportation, Derby Train Station offers several options. A taxi rank can be found on the station forecourt for quick, convenient transfers. The KinchBus's "Skylink" service operates a 24-hour schedule connecting passengers directly to East Midlands Airport, ensuring easy access to international travel.

Bus services are also comprehensively covered, with information readily available and even in a printable format for the organized traveler. For those moments when regular service is disrupted, rail replacement services can be accessed from the Pride Park exit, ensuring continuity of travel.

Additional Features

For daily commuters and travelers with bicycles, Derby Station provides 204 sheltered bike spaces equipped with CCTV for peace of mind. The car park runs 24 hours with a range of tickets catering to short and long stays, making it convenient for all types of travelers. Refreshment facilities at the station ensure you are fueled and ready for your journey, and while there's no public Wi-Fi, the spacious waiting areas come with comfortable seating and heating.

Station Facilities and Services

Getting your tickets at Stoke-on-Trent station is a breeze. With a ticket office open on weekdays from 05:55 to 20:00 and a host of ticket machines available on-site, upgrading your travel plans at the last minute is never an issue. If you've purchased tickets online, collection is also straightforward via a convenient ticket machine, though it's worth noting that the ticket machines are presently not accessible for those with mobility impairments.

To ensure a comfortable journey for all passengers, the station features step-free access throughout. While there are no accessible taxis directly at the station, there is a set-down and pick-up point for impaired mobility passengers. A variety of staff-led support services are available from 05:30 to midnight on weekdays, ready to assist with any inquiries. Whether it's directions, train times or a bit of assistance with luggage, help is always at hand.

Onward Travel from Stoke-on-Trent

Transport connections are robust, offering multiple ways to continue your journey once you've stepped off the train at Stoke-on-Trent. If you're catching a ride by bike, you can make use of the Brompton Bike Hire located at the station. For bus connections, Stoke-on-Trent station provides direct access to rail replacement services right at its doorstep. A landscaped bus interchange is also available, providing printable information to plan your onward journey for ultimate convenience.
